NSC hails Nigeria wrestlers’ stellar performance at 2025 African Championships

The National Sports Commission (NSC) has congratulated Nigerian wrestlers for their remarkable performance at the 2025 Senior Wrestling Championships held in Morocco.
The Nigerian female team emerged as the overall champions for the 14th time, securing nine gold medals.
In addition, Nigeria claimed the African Championship in men’s wrestling for the first time in four years, with former junior international Steve Simon Izolo winning a gold medal, further reinforcing Nigeria’s dominance in African wrestling.
